Yahoo Sports has published a ranking of the 16 SEC college towns based on their population as estimated for July 1, 2025. Austin, Texas, home to the University of Texas, tops the list with a population of 1,002,632, followed by Nashville, Tennessee, which hosts Vanderbilt University with a population of 721,074. Other notable towns include Lexington, Kentucky, and Baton Rouge, Louisiana, highlighting how the SEC features a mix of larger cities and smaller towns. The rankings aim to illustrate the diversity of environments surrounding these institutions.
- •Austin, Texas, ranks first with over 1 million residents.
- •Nashville and Lexington follow as significant urban centers.
- •Half of the SEC towns have populations between 100,000 and 150,000.
- •All population data is estimated from the U.S. Census.
